My friends at Samsung gave me the Galaxy Note to play with at this year’s SXSW.

It’s a sort of tablet-meets-phone. A smartphone with a HUGE screen and little drawing stylus.

I drew the cartoon above on the Note. No, I really did. With the little stylus that comes with it (You can alos use a regular-sized Wacom styles with it as well, if your fingers are to big etc). Fun!

Besides that, it takes pictures, which you can THEN DRAW OVER on the spot. Here’s a picture I did yesterday here in San Antonio (I’m here visiting with my clients at Rackspace):

As an artist, this Android-powered device allows me to do stuff on the the go that my iPhone simply doesn’t. That is HUGE for me.

Here’s another one; this time at a Texas Hill Country Beef Jerky place 100 miles West of town, yesterday morning:

I’ve had nothing but fun since I got it. I understand other artists were given one to try out at SXSW (Follow their campaign hashtag, #BeNoteworthy), so we’ll see what kind of collective interest can be gotten over the weekend there.

My take? Frankly, I’m delighted by it. I’m not saying the Note is the new “iPhone Killer”; that being said, it’s quite reassuring to know that the iPhone is no longer the ONLY game in town. As a traditional iPhone user, I was accustomed to thinking that Android was just a poor man’s iPhone. And then the Note comes along and proves me wrong. Dead wrong.
